Our Foundation Year provides an excellent alternative route to Keele, providing a unique opportunity to better prepare for your chosen degree, and with guaranteed entry onto your undergraduate course once you successfully complete your Foundation Year. This extra year of study can improve your academic skills, expand your subject knowledge, give you a better understanding of higher education and, perhaps most importantly of all, build your confidence. On the Keele Foundation Year, you'll study on campus, joining our undergraduate community from the outset, with access to all the facilities and support that you'd get as an undergraduate student at Keele.

Environment and SustainabilityDo you want to be part of a new generation of environmental champions leading the way to a more sustainable future? Are you keen to develop a comprehensive understanding of current global challenges? From biodiversity loss to resource depletion, you’ll explore a range of issues on our Sustainability and Environmental Management BSc. Through hands-on fieldwork, laboratory projects, and industry placements, you'll gain the practical experience needed to become a highly valued professional in careers such as environmental consultant, nature conservation officer, or recycling specialist.
Why choose this course?- Top 20 in the UK for Earth and Marine Sciences (Guardian University Guide, 2025).- Our unique 600-acre campus offers a fantastic natural environment to perform fieldwork- Enhance your employability with study abroad and work placement options- Assessment is by coursework, with no formal exams- Accredited by the Institution of Environmental Sciences (IES)Our world is facing significant environmental problems, and we urgently need to find solutions to mitigate the devastating impact humans have on our planet. Our Sustainability and Environmental Management BSc will provide you with a comprehensive understanding of environmental science, policy and management, and equip you with the professional skills necessary for a dynamic career in the sustainability sector. The programme has been designed to provide you with a solid foundation in sustainability and environmental management in your first year, preparing you for advanced study in years two and three. You will explore concepts from ecology, environmental science, geography and social sciences, and study topics such as sustainable resource management, clean technology and renewable energy, environmental impact assessment and environmental change.
